Tilki

The most widespread wild carnivore on Earth, red foxes have colonized habitats from Arctic tundra to urban environments across the Northern Hemisphere and introduced ranges in Australia. Recognized by their russet coat, white belly, and bushy tail. Highly adaptable omnivores, red foxes eat everything from rabbits and voles to fruit and human refuse. They communicate with over 40 distinct vocalizations.
